Transaction 857816a24f140957da4be039118d6fcad359cf6a5b8045807f0b66c88bd7b373

block
93d1db9695bdd3bce6a3b4e4720035636fa21764a94d1ca84c9843bd4d33b15a

1 Input

2 Outputs